Mandatory E-Filing in Racine

1/31/2017

1 Comment

 
This letter was sent to the RCBA from the Clerk of Courts, Samuel Christensen:

To the Members of the Racine County Bar Association: 

As you may be aware, Racine County is currently a mandatory electronic filing (efiling) county for Civil, Small Claims, Paternity, and Family cases. We became a mandatory efiling county on December 1st, 2016. This means that filings in these case types MUST be submitted electronically by attorneys. 

On January 18th, 2017, voluntary efiling for criminal cases (Felony, Misdemeanor, 
Criminal Traffic, and Forfeitures cases) became available. This means that these case 
types are available to attorneys via the efiling system but is not required. 

I wanted to make you aware that beginning on March 1st, 2017, efiling for criminal cases will become mandatory. 

If you are not already familiar with the Wisconsin Courts’ Website for electronic filing (www.wicourts.gov/efile), I would highly recommend visiting it for more information. It is an excellent resource for information on how to use the efiling system.

Volunteer for the Racine Mock Trial Competition in February!

1/13/2017

0 Comments

 
It’s time again for the Wisconsin High School MOCK TRIAL TOURNAMENT to be held at the Law Enforcement Center, 717 Wisconsin Avenue, Racine, Wisconsin
 
Regional Tournament February 11, 2017 comprising of 12 teams conducting 6 morning sessions and 6 afternoon sessions.  Exact starting time schedules to be determined.
 
You are encouraged to sign up as a Presiding Judge, Scoring Judge, or Score Sheet Runner for all day, morning, or afternoon trials.   
 
Sign up on the State Bar of Wisconsin website’s direct link www.wisbar.org/mocktrial .  Once there click on the forVolunteer tab and enter your information, availability and position preference for the semifinal tournament, February 11, 2017.

Thank you to all who participated in the Santa to a Senior program

1/11/2017

0 Comments

 
“Thank you so much to all of our members for your participation in this year’s Be a Santa to a Senior program!!  

​In total, 903 lonely and needy seniors in our community received a bit of joy on Christmas this year, 50 of which received your generous gifts!  

In addition to lonely seniors, the RCBA made gifts to the Veterans outreach program which is currently assisting 15 homeless vets in our area.
